Technical Specifications

Parameter Node Detailed Engineering Specification
Manufacturer Tokyo Electron Device (TED / TEL)
Part Number (MPN) TE7754PF
Device Architecture Expanded Parallel/Serial I/O Controller Hub Interface
Serial Interfaces 2-Channel Asynchronous UART (Built-in 8-Byte FIFO/ch)
Parallel I/O Matrix 8-bit Parallel Structure (Configurable into 9 distinct group ports)
Analog Channels 8-Channel Built-in Analog Voltage Converter Subsystem
Timer Configurations Integrated Multi-mode Programmable PWM Timer Engine
Operating Voltage DC 5.0V Core Logic Constraint Rail
Package / Case QFP-100 (Plastic Quad Flat Package, 16mm × 16mm body)
Temperature Range 0°C to +70°C Standard Commercial Spectrum Operation
